Serre’s Problem on Projective Modules


Presents some of the most comprehensive view available on the mathematics of 'Serre's Conjecture'. This title includes such coverage as stably free modules and the basic calculus of unimodular rows, Suslin's Normality and Factorial Theorems, and a survey of research since 1978.
